About Sharon White

Sharon White is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ology, General Health Professions and Epidemiology, having authored 104 papers that have together received 1.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(7 papers),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(7 papers), Renal and Vascular Pathologies (6 papers),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(4 papers), Hepatocellular Carcinoma Treatment and Prognosis (4 papers), Pancreatic function and diabetes (4 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(4 papers) and Online and Blended Learning (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medical Services (219 citations), Transplantation (68 citations), Nephrology (160 citations), Hepatology (124 citations) and Oncology (377 citations). Sharon White has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Dennis Fowler, Derek Manas, Gavin J. Murphy, Michael L. Nicholson, Dean B. Evans, William R. Miller, Rajiv Lochan, Stuart Robinson, J. Michael Dixon and M L Nicholson. Their work appears in journals such as British journal of surgery, European Journal of Surgical Oncology, Gut, Journal of Clinical Oncology and European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ery.
